Type
ORACLE
Validation date
2025-10-14 17:38: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.6809e-4,
    "usd": 4.2672e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F4C98F2BD46691D655CD8464AB66FCE4423352B5913F3399861143C536A5CE18

Previous signature

E022AEDB0910FD414F199D749687331DC55B40B32B872366674B41A8DC8D5C35BB08E2777097072B7AD318057D79FC1B0E99AB1F6AA4456D553921B0FA5EE002

Origin signature

3046022100B5E4E7413987A70D0DC39908F3E8FF45108623C6C8DF540EDDE20E0875A3C932022100E7A40518934A37A3D7F93EF91D9B8F2E421297DDA529A0492F3FB4C173DEBB1D

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

0072DEE352B69CABD5829CBF7AC5D46F425F6DEBEBB4787D6AD81E562A46C23881

Coordinator signature

B36CDA9212195E58E9E31E00740DD1B2A5B9E09D0DEF1E81EA726579A2BCF5A4A807E755C790322E3D21159081BB5A68401B25138AF132200E00A6EEEF886507

Validator #1 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#1 signature

38C5133A5AC8A3EF89F63260F5E7CDA1FCC79F93442CD333965C6BA85B738B55D5D0264F821D316E0412B44C50EAEBDE6AA92567B63060540131877D4B05DE0C

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

C1F85EBE965EA03EFD2EB2781D71FC637B4D3D264E36A61832116AB6680AF3CDB478BF646F0D665BBDAC10D35C117EBF4DAEA31D599718EC6772D325CF3A7A06